VP urges easing procedures, better services for Yemeni pilgrims

RIYADH-SABA
Vice President Lieutenant General (Lt Gen) Ali Mohssen Saleh met Sunday with the Minister of Endowments and Guidance Ahmed Atiah.
Necessary procedures and arrangements for Yemeni pilgrims in the coming season were key focus of the Minister's talks with the Vince President.
Atiah reported to (Lt Gen) Mohssen about the ongoing efforts aiming to coordinate with the authorities in charge in Kingdom of Saudi Arabia.
The Vince President urged better coordination with the Saudi authorities to help the Yemeni pilgrims performing their pilgrimage journey as comfortable as possible.
Mohssen also instructed the Minister to act responsibly, prevent any illegal practices or anybody may attempt to extort the pilgrims.
